Chinese equities closed mixed, with the key index down slightly, on Tuesday as investors were worried about the plunge of Wall Street and peripheral markets. The benchmark Shanghai Composite Index closed at 1,889.64 points, down 0.26 percent or 4.98 points. The smaller Shenzhen Component Index rose 0.47 percent, or 31.84 points, to close at 6,795.81. A Chinese bank employee counts stacks of hundred yuan notes at a bank in Beijing. China's currency is being scrutinised ahead of a US-China summit after it fell sharply against the dollar in what experts have said could mark a new policy shift aimed at propping up flagging exports.

Dec. 2 (Bloomberg) -- KKR & Co. LP ., the private equity company of Henry Kravis and George Roberts, plans to invest $100 million in Chinese raw milk supplier Modern Farm to tap growth in an $18 billion market, two people familiar with the plan said.

(RTTNews) - The Chinese yuan edged down to 6.8916 against the US dollar during early Asian deals on Tuesday. This set the lowest point for the yuan since June 19, 2008. On the downside, 6.937 is seen as the next target level for the Chinese currency.
